How much does an Executive Secretary III make in Maine? The average Executive Secretary III salary in Maine is $86,390 as of March 26, 2024, but the range typically falls between $76,790 and $97,690.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on the city and many other important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ession.

Executive Secretary III Salaries by Percentile
Percentile Salary Location Last Updated
10th Percentile Executive Secretary III Salary $68,050 ME March 26, 2024
25th Percentile Executive Secretary III Salary $76,790 ME March 26, 2024
50th Percentile Executive Secretary III Salary $86,390 ME March 26, 2024
75th Percentile Executive Secretary III Salary $97,690 ME March 26, 2024
90th Percentile Executive Secretary III Salary $107,978 ME March 26, 2024

Job Description

The Executive Secretary III handles a wide range of administrative and support tasks and independently initiates and implements processes to manage projects, information, and people. Provides multi-faceted administrative support and assistance to ensure effective use of an executive's time and productive interactions with staff and the public. Being an Executive Secretary III conducts research and information gathering on behalf of the executive and prepares summaries and reports. Manages the executive's schedule, meeting preparations, follow-up tasks, and complex travel arrangements. In addition, Executive Secretary III develops positive and strategic relationships at all levels of the organization. Uses discretion, judgement, and knowledge of the organization to facilitate the executive's activities and maintain confidentiality. May be responsible for directing and deploying support staff or other resources. Typically requires a bachelor's degree or equivalent. Typically reports to a C-suite executive. Being an Executive Secretary III work is generally independent and collaborative in nature. Contributes to moderately complex aspects of a project. Working as an Executive Secretary III typically requires 4 -7 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
